I contacted Microsoft tech support and they replied:

I understand that when you attempting to connect to IMAP4 server,
there is an error 17495. If I have misunderstood, please let me know.

I am sorry; this is a known issue currently when you try to connect to
Domino IMAP4 server. Our developer has fixed this problem, but I am
afraid you have to wait for the next release Office 2004 update to fix
it.
